Gaming blockchain Ronin records 2M daily active users: Token Terminal
The Ronin network surpassed other blockchains in daily active users (DAU) as its gaming-dedicated ecosystem reached several milestones in 2024.
On July 29, the onchain data platform Token Terminal showed that the Ronin network recorded a two million DAU count, surpassing other active blockchains like Tron ( TRX ) and Solana ( SOL ). Tron was in the second spot with 1.8 million active users, while Solana had 1.2 million users in the last 24 hours.
According to Token Terminal, its daily active users’ chart represents the number of distinct addresses interacting with business-relevant contracts. The data includes users transacting and engaging within the network.

Ronin’s ecosystem continues to expand
In its mid-year review published on July 23, the Ronin team highlighted factors that may have influenced the increase in active users.
According to Ronin, its growth in the first half of 2024 was partly driven by a surge in volume for its non-fungible token (NFT) marketplace called Mavis Market and the listing of the Ronin (RON) token on Binance. The Ronin team believes this gave users a “portal” into its “gamers country.”
The team also reported 12 million RON holders and over three million downloads for its Ronin Wallet. The network also highlighted that its ecosystem now has 15 playable games and noted that more games are being developed.
Pixels migration and zkEVM plans
Pixels, one of the largest Web3 games by user count, also migrated to Ronin in February 2024. The network reported that the game’s monthly active users peaked at 1.7 million in June. According to Ronin, players spent over 15 million in Pixels ( PIXEL ) tokens for the game’s VIP coupons in the last 12 months.
Apart from gaming, the Ronin network also enhanced its technology stack. On June 18, revealed its plans to introduce Ronin zkEVM , a zero-knowledge (ZK) Ethereum Virtual Machine (EVM) layer-2 chain with a modified version of the Polygon Chain Development Kit (CDK).
According to Sky Mavis, the team behind Ronin, this will “further decentralize Ronin” using ZK-proof layer-2 rollups. The team also believes that it would prepare the network to handle billions in transactions in the future.
